Who are you?

We are looking for a talented professional with medical copywriting skills that also acts as an engagement partner with clients on brands, participates in client-facing discussions, content strategy shaping, and consultative inputs. This role would complement the design team while working for our client in the pharmaceutical industry.

The focus of the role will be to create promotional communication content. This role will also be involved in client engagement and act as a consultant for medical content strategy, lead content direction, and provide solutions for the right messaging for promotional claims with PAAB compliance. You should be recognized as a brand expert with an ability to translate the science and data into compelling promotional copy complying with medical, regulatory, legal, and compliance guidelines. The aim is to 'make the complex simple' adapting larger pieces of content to create smaller, easy-to-read materials for digital and non-digital channels, maintaining key medical messaging and being able to anchor medical literature references.

Creativity, innovative thinking, and problem-solving should be at the heart of all you do.
